If your power was lost or even flickered on Halloween night, you were one of 15,000 people affected by a wide-spread power outage.

It swept through a large part of the city of Erie after a reported transformer fire just before 9:30 Friday night.

It sparked in a substation in harborcreek. Penelec tells us crews are on the scene, and they're still investigating what caused the substation to
malfunction. 

 Penelec spokesman Bill Jerin said power should be restored to most customers by midnight.
